Smith County, TX (October 13, 2024) – A tragic two-vehicle collision occurred on Friday, resulting in the ejection of one individual from a vehicle and confirming one fatality due to injuries sustained in the crash. The incident took place on State Highway 64, prompting authorities to shut down the highway in both directions from County Road 220 to County Road 289.
The accident was first reported at approximately 4:18 p.m., and as of 5:40 p.m., traffic remained blocked while emergency responders worked at the scene. According to Smith County Sheriff’s Office spokesperson Larry Christian, the collision involved a truck and a car.
Emergency responders, including UT Health East Texas EMS, the Chapel Hill Fire Department, and the Arp Fire Department, were dispatched to assist at the scene. While one person has tragically lost their life, the identity of the deceased has not yet been released.
The wreck occurred in proximity to Chapel Hill High School, and drivers are advised to exercise caution and avoid the area if possible.
